Location and Meeting Point

The experience begins in front of Entrance 1 of the Eiffel Tower, a spot that’s easy to find and perfect for starting your Parisian adventure. You and your children will meet Emilie, the guide and illustrator, who has brought along a variety of drawing materials and templates. Weather permitting, the group sits comfortably on the lawn at Trocadéro, facing the Eiffel Tower—arguably the best spot in Paris for a panoramic view and memorable photos.

The Itinerary and Activity Details

The 30-minute session is straightforward but thoughtfully designed. Emilie provides a selection of templates, featuring the Eiffel Tower with fun twists—like candy, rainbows, strawberries, or even a giraffe. This creative approach sparks children’s imaginations, encouraging them to personalize their drawings with colors and patterns of their choosing.

The guide is described as helpful and skilled, capable of assisting children with their drawings. As one parent noted, “Emilie is an illustrator, so if you need help, she’ll be there.” Kids are encouraged to sign and date their artwork, transforming it into a cherished souvenir.

What’s Included and Accessibility

All drawing materials are included, so there’s no need to bring your own supplies. The activity is wheelchair accessible and available as a private group, allowing for tailored attention and a more relaxed pace. The experience also offers full flexibility: you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, making it a worry-free addition to your itinerary.

Weather Contingency and Location Change

If rain strikes, the activity isn’t canceled outright but relocated to the nearby garden of the Quai Branly Museum or under the bridge along the Seine. This ensures kids can still enjoy their creative time outdoors or in a sheltered setting, which is a thoughtful touch.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is the workshop suitable for all ages?
It’s designed for children, with templates and assistance from Emilie. Babies under 1 year are not suitable for this activity.

How long does the activity last?
It lasts approximately 30 minutes, making it easy to fit into a busy sightseeing schedule.

Is the activity accessible for wheelchairs?
Yes, it is wheelchair accessible, ensuring most families can participate comfortably.

What happens if it rains?
If it rains, the activity is moved to an indoor location at the Quai Branly Museum or under the bridge along the Seine, so your plans aren’t disrupted.

Are there options for groups or private bookings?
Yes, the experience is offered as a private group, allowing for personalized attention and a more intimate setting.

What’s included in the price?
All drawing materials are provided, so you don’t need to bring anything along.

Can I cancel if my plans change?
Absolutely. You can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, making it flexible for spontaneous or uncertain schedules.
